From 9e79706c3b01bca8674b218b1017bcd47f541fa8 Mon Sep 17 00:00:00 2001 From: Ivan Levkivskyi Date: Thu, 19 Feb 2026 12:52:25 +0000 Subject: [PATCH] Fix couple more edge cases type comments/strings --- mypy/nativeparse.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/mypy/nativeparse.py b/mypy/nativeparse.py index 7b4570856e0f..13676c9058b5 100644 --- a/mypy/nativeparse.py +++ b/mypy/nativeparse.py @@ -964,8 +964,7 @@ def read_type(state: State, data: ReadBuffer) -> Type: union = UnionType(items, uses_pep604_syntax=uses_pep604_syntax) union.original_str_expr = original_str_expr union.original_str_fallback = original_str_fallback - if original_str_expr is not None: - union.is_evaluated = False + union.is_evaluated = read_bool(data) read_loc(data, union) expect_end_tag(data) return union